AFL Round 13 Review (Season 2025)

Facts and Figures

Average Score: 62.88 points per team, which is very low, due to Hawthorn being the highest score of any team, with just 81 points.
Average Winning Margin: 16.25 points per game, which indicates there were relatively close games, which makes it understandable that four games had a margin of ten points or less.

AFL Round 13 Review (Season 2024)

Facts and Figures

Average Score: 77.31 points per team, which is fairly low, because only two out of 16 teams that played scored over 100 points.
Average Winning Margin: 20.38 points per game, which indicates there were relatively close games; there were three out of eight games that had a margin of less than ten points.

AFL Round 13 Review (Season 2023)

Facts and Figures

Average Score: 83.38 points per team, which is understandable when taking into account three out of 16 teams scored 100 points or more.
Average Winning Margin: 33.25 points per game, which indicates there were relatively one-sided games. Despite that, it was fairly low when taking into account there was a game with a margin of 122 points.
